getVerb

public Verb getVerb()
This gets the verb that describes this operation. Multiple operations may return the same verb, however verbs must be unique across the preferred operations. That is only one prefered operation may implement the "mute" verb. There may be deprecated operations that implement the "mute" verb but these will be less performant as they will be implemented as wrappers for the preferred "mute" operation.

Returns:
the verb that describes the operation.
